Oppo Find X9s Pro Global Launch Confirmed for April 21: Here is What to Expect
Oppo just confirmed that its highly anticipated Find X9s Pro is hitting the global market very soon. From ultra-thin bezels to four beautiful colors, the official pre-order pages have revealed almost everything. Here are the details.

Last week, Oppo made some noise by announcing its new Find X9 series for the Chinese market. But if you were worried that these premium phones wouldn't make it to other countries, we have some good news.
Oppo has officially confirmed that the Find X9s Pro will make its global debut on April 21 at 7 PM local time in China. Even better, the company has already started taking pre-orders on its official website, which completely revealed the design, memory variants, and color options of the new phone.
A Compact Screen with Tiny Bezels Most premium phones these days are huge and hard to hold, but Oppo is taking a different route with the Find X9s Pro. The official page confirms that the phone will feature a very comfortable 6.3-inch display.
To make it look completely futuristic, Oppo managed to shrink the screen bezels down to just 1.1mm. This means almost the entire front of the phone is just pure screen.
Memory Options and Four New Colors You won't run out of storage space with this one. The pre-order page shows that the Find X9s Pro will come in four different memory combinations. You can choose between:

12GB RAM with 256GB storage

12GB RAM with 512GB storage

16GB RAM with 512GB storage

A massive 16GB RAM with 1TB of storage for heavy users.
The phone also looks stunning from the back. It will be available in four fresh colors: a bright Teal/Green, a soft Purple, a premium Peach/Pink, and a classic Dark Grey.
Dual 200MP Cameras Oppo's partnership with camera maker Hasselblad continues this year. While the full spec sheet isn't out yet, the official site confirms that the back will house two massive 200MP Hasselblad cameras. Getting two 200MP sensors on a phone of this size is a very big deal, and it should take incredibly detailed photos.

TecHoper's Take What really caught our attention is the 6.3-inch screen size. It is very hard to find a truly premium "compact" phone right now, especially one that packs up to 1TB of storage and two 200MP cameras. Most brands save their best cameras for their biggest phones. If Oppo can manage the battery life properly on a smaller device, the Find X9s Pro could easily become the favorite phone for people who hate carrying heavy, bulky devices.
We don't know the exact price yet, but we will find out everything on April 21.
